Jeffrey Alan Delaney, Galesburg, MI, passed away on Thursday, July 7, 2022, at the age 40.
Jeffrey was born in Corona, CA, on October 8, 1981, the son of the late Brian Keith Delaney and Diane Ceceilia Delaney. Jeff was not married but in a serious relationship with Cari Biland. Jeff had no children of his own but helped raise a stepdaughter to the age of 10, Elizabeth "Pip". Jeff is also survived by his brothers, Joseph Lee (Carolyn) Delaney and Brian Andrew (Kasey) Delaney; grandparents, Jim and Ceal Place.
Jeff has left many aunts, uncles, cousins, nieces, and nephews.
Jeff graduated from Hollister High School. He had also graduated from UTI Auto Tech. His true passion was in cooking. He loved to cook and has a list of restaurants on his resume. His second passion was fishing, either in summer or ice fishing.
Jeff is now in the Kingdom of God.
Cremation has taken place and a private family gathering will be held later. Arrangements were entrusted to Langeland Family Funeral Homes Burial and Cremation Services, 622 S Burdick St, Kalamazoo, MI 49007.
